The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) program prepares students for professional paths including healthcare fields like medicine and dentistry, environmental sciences, veterinary practice, patent law, high school science teaching, or forensic chemistry. The Chemical Education Major fulfills all Florida state requirements for 6-12 grade teaching certification. Students can collaborate with department faculty - many with interdisciplinary expertise - in their research laboratories. Some participants showcase their findings at national conferences and in chemistry publications.
This specialization provides students with thorough chemistry training while enabling them to address environmental challenges and pursue eco-focused careers.
